日期:2014-05-20  浏览次数:20723 次

Spring <aop:aspectj-autoproxy>
我的配置文件里只有一个bean是有@Aspect标注的,我用<aop:aspectj-autoproxy>自动建立代理,但他老是吧别的类也算在里面,哪些类根本没有@Aspect标注的,所以就一直出错,
我在标签里又加了<aop:include name="dl2"/>但是我不知道name使之哪里的name
我加了没报错,但是运行时也没有前后多家的方法执行,相当于没有

------解决方案--------------------
此处的name指的是引用一个bean的id
------解决方案--------------------
0 formal unbound in pointcut
没有绑定切点
@Aspect
public class NotVeryUsefulAspect {
@Pointcut("execution(public * *(..))")
private void anyPublicOperation() {}